If you are under 18, you will need six hours of professional drivers training before you can take your DMV driving test. A single driving lesson is 2 hours. How many hours you require depends on your goals, driving skills, and comfort level on the road.
Most sources agree that 35-50 hours of driving lessons is better. The average amount of driving lessons should be 40-45 hours before taking your driving test. Some people decide that 20-30 hours or maybe even less is enough – but remember that the more lessons you take, the better you will become at driving.
While you cannot start driving a car when you are 16, you can use your provisional driving licence to learn to drive other vehicles. At 16, you can legally learn to drive a moped in the UK, and you can do this once you’ve received your provisional licence.
The DVLA says that the average hours to pass the driving test for people who pass the first time is around 45 hours of lessons with a driving instructor, supplemented by 20 hours of supervised practice with family or friends. Most learners’ average time to pass driving test is around four to five months.
Amaxophobia (also called hamaxophobia) makes you feel anxious or fearful when you drive or ride in a vehicle, such as a car, bus or plane. With it, you have a fear of driving and may also get anxious being a passenger. This fear can interfere with work, socializing and travel.
